Procedures for Requesting Maintenance Services. The County generally anticipates performing repairs and maintenance during hours that are most convenient to program operations. Except in emergencies, the County will endeavor to notify the Contractor by phone or email in advance when such work will be performed during peak-occupancy hours. The County will inform all Department of Environmental Services (DES) staff and outside contractors of guest confidentiality rules. The Contractor’s staff will maintain a log of all contractors who performed routine work on the facility, to include date, time, and work performed. To avoid unauthorized work or duplicate applications for service or project work, DES will accept requests only from designated DHS and program staff.
